Summary of differences between red Wine and coleslaw

  • Red Wine has less vitamin K, vitamin C, fiber, polyunsaturated fat, and monounsaturated fat than coleslaw.
  • Coleslaw covers your daily need for vitamin K, 59% more than red Wine.
  • Red Wine has less sugar.
  • The glycemic index of coleslaw is higher.

These are the specific foods used in this comparison Alcoholic beverage, wine, table, red and Fast foods, coleslaw.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Red Wine Coleslaw DV% diff.
Vitamin K 0.4µg 70.9µg 59%
Polyunsaturated fat 0g 5.348g 36%
Vitamin C 0mg 14.6mg 16%
Fats 0g 9.91g 15%
Sodium 4mg 203mg 9%
Fiber 0g 1.9g 8%
Saturated fat 0g 1.599g 7%
Monounsaturated fat 0g 2.671g 7%
Carbs 2.61g 14.89g 4%
Vitamin B6 0.057mg 0.112mg 4%
Vitamin B5 0.03mg 0.246mg 4%
Vitamin E 0mg 0.54mg 4%
Vitamin A 0µg 28µg 3%
Iron 0.46mg 0.22mg 3%
Calories 85kcal 153kcal 3%
